  • In this video I am carving out a wooden spoon from European Aspen in the woods of Sweden.
    I am using some fine Gränsfors Bruks axes to chop off the most of the wood to form the spoon/ladle. Then using some mora knifes for the fine work.
    Tools used in this video:
    Gränsfors Bruks small forest axe
    Gränsfors Bruks mini hatchet
    morakniv 120
    Mora Classic No1, carbon
    Mora 164 Hook knife
    Pencil
